* Mike Fedyk ([EMAIL PROTECTED]) wrote:
I see this on my system also, but I disagree that there is any attempt at keeping the same location.

The only reason why the position of the scroll cursor changes is because there is more or less content in the window. The relative position stays the same.

I'm guessing this is no better in 1.5?
No, pretty much the same.

Here are some more things I have noticed after resizing the page a few times in 1.5.

I used http://lwca.org/library/articles/kh6sr/artndb10.htm. If you press page down twice and resize the page larger or smaller, you are always two screens from the top. So no matter what size you resize to, you can always press page up twice to get to the top.

So it is not the content viewed, but the number of pixels from the top that is tracked from what I can gather without looking at the code.
